Bill SB 1658, introduced on January 23, 2025, aims to address various aspects of traffic management and enforcement in the state. The bill has passed its first reading and has undergone amendments, receiving a recommendation for passage from the Transportation and Communications Committee (TCA).
The primary intent of SB 1658 is to streamline the handling of uncontested traffic cases and enhance the efficiency of traffic management systems. The bill also focuses on the development and funding of the Lahaina Bypass, which is expected to alleviate traffic congestion in the area.
Uncontested Traffic Cases: The bill proposes specific procedures for managing uncontested traffic violations, which are expected to reduce the burden on the judiciary and expedite case resolutions.
Lahaina Bypass Development: SB 1658 includes provisions for the planning and funding of the Lahaina Bypass, aiming to improve traffic flow and safety in Lahaina, a region known for heavy traffic congestion.
State Highway Fund: The bill outlines potential allocations from the State Highway Fund to support the initiatives related to the Lahaina Bypass and other traffic management improvements.
Drivers and Commuters: The bill is expected to benefit drivers and commuters in Lahaina by reducing traffic congestion and improving travel times.
Judiciary System: The proposed changes to uncontested traffic cases will impact the judiciary by streamlining processes and potentially reducing case loads.
Department of Transportation (DOT): The DOT will be involved in the implementation of the provisions related to the Lahaina Bypass and traffic management strategies.
SB 1658 represents a significant step towards improving traffic management and enforcement in the state, particularly in the Lahaina area. By addressing uncontested traffic cases and investing in infrastructure like the Lahaina Bypass, the bill aims to enhance the overall efficiency of the traffic system and improve the commuting experience for residents and visitors alike.
